Senate education spending panel considers school safety pricetag

Florida lawmakers are beginning to compile a shopping list of security items for public schools. The Senate Appropriations Education Subcommittee on Wednesday invited representatives from Baker, Orange, St. Johns and Volusia counties to a brainstorming session as it prepares to write legislation in response to last month’s Connecticut elementary school massacre.
